Step-by-Step Installation Guide

  1. Choose the installation location: Ideally, the cat flap need to be installed in a door or wall that offers direct access to the outdoors.
  2. Measure and mark the door: Use a pencil to mark the center point of the cat flap on the door.
  3. Cut a hole: Use a saw or craft knife to produce a hole in the door, following the manufacturer's guidelines for shapes and size.
  4. Connect the cat flap: Use screws and hinges to secure the cat flap to the door, guaranteeing correct alignment and a smooth operation.
  5. Add a lock: Install the lock according to the manufacturer's guidelines, ensuring it's safe and tamper-proof.
  6. Weatherproof the location: Apply sealant and weatherproofing materials to prevent drafts and moisture entry.
  7. Test the cat flap: Ensure the flap opens and closes smoothly, and the lock is working correctly.

Regularly Asked Questions

  1. Q: Can I set up a cat flap in a wall?A: Yes, but it might need extra products and labor to develop an appropriate opening.
  2. Q: Can I use a cat flap in a double-glazed door?A: Yes, however you might require to seek advice from a professional to make sure an appropriate installation.
  3. Q: How do I avoid other animals from going into through the cat flap?A: Use a safe and secure lock, and consider adding a magnetic or electronic system to control access.
  4. Q: Can I install a cat flap myself?A: Yes, however if you're not comfy with DIY projects or unsure about the installation, think about consulting a professional.
